About N. Vansteenkiste

N. Vansteenkiste is a scholar working on Acoustics and Ultrasonics, Atomic and Molecular Physics, and Optics, Statistical and Nonlinear Physics, Statistics, Probability and Uncertainty and Artificial Intelligence, having authored 17 papers that have together received 1.3k indexed citations. Recurring topics across this work include Cold Atom Physics and Bose-Einstein Condensates (12 papers), Mechanical and Optical Resonators (5 papers), Quantum optics and atomic interactions (4 papers), Atomic and Subatomic Physics Research (3 papers), Advanced Frequency and Time Standards (3 papers), Quantum Mechanics and Applications (3 papers), Quantum Information and Cryptography (3 papers) and Photonic and Optical Devices (2 papers). The work is most often cited by research in Atomic and Molecular Physics, and Optics (1.3k citations), Acoustics and Ultrasonics (20 citations), Artificial Intelligence (307 citations), Statistical and Nonlinear Physics (111 citations) and Spectroscopy (101 citations). N. Vansteenkiste has collaborated with scholars based in France, Denmark and Germany. Frequent co-authors include Alain Aspect, Robin Kaiser, Claude Cohen‐Tannoudji, E. Arimondo, C. I. Westbrook, E. Arimondo, G. Labeyrie, Arnaud Landragin, J.-Y. Courtois and W. Seifert. Their work appears in journals such as Physical Review Letters, Optics Communications, Physical Review A, Journal de Physique II and Journal of the Optical Society of America B.
